INTRUST FUNDS TRUST
Supplement dated December 29, 1999
to Prospectus dated March 5, 1999
On December 28, 1999, the shareholders of the Stock Fund of INTRUST
Funds Trust ("Trust") approved new sub-advisory arrangements between AMR
Investment Services, Inc. ("AMR") and INTRUST Bank, N.A., the investment adviser
to the Stock Fund (the "Sub-Advisory Agreement") and between Barrow, Hanley,
Mewhinney & Strauss, Inc. ("Barrow Hanley") and AMR (the "AMR Agreement"). AMR
currently serves as Sub-Adviser for the INTRUST Money Market Fund. AMR will
retain Barrow Hanley to manage the Stock Fund's investments. The current
sub-adviser for the Stock Fund, Ark Asset Management Company, Inc. resigned as
sub-adviser effective December 31, 1999. The change in sub-advisers will not
result in any change in advisory fees currently paid by the Stock Fund to
INTRUST Bank, N.A.
A description of AMR is contained in the Prospectus. Barrow Hanley is
an investment firm whose main office is at 3232 McKinney Avenue, 15th floor,
Dallas, TX 75204. Barrow Haley provides sub-advisory investment services to
other mutual fund companies and, as of June 30, 1999, had sub-advisory
relationships totaling over $20 billion in assets.
